On my MacBook Pro 2,2 I am still having problems with the battery
indicator.  What happens is after a number of hours (less than 24
usually) my battery indicator goes to mostly 0:

crazyharry BAT0 # cat /proc/acpi/battery/BAT0/info
present:                 yes
design capacity:         0 mWh
last full capacity:      0 mWh
battery technology:      rechargeable
design voltage:          0 mV
design capacity warning: 250 mWh
design capacity low:     100 mWh
capacity granularity 1:  10 mWh
capacity granularity 2:  10 mWh
model number:
serial number:
battery type:
OEM info:

crazyharry BAT0 # cat /proc/acpi/battery/BAT0/state
present:                 yes
capacity state:          ok
charging state:          charging
present rate:            0 mW
remaining capacity:      0 mWh
present voltage:         0 mV

It stays there until I either reboot into MacOS, or reset the battery
controller (remove battery and ac adapter and hold the power button down
for 5 seconds).

I have seen this problem mentioned on the list before, but I was
wondering if anyone has figured out what is going on to cause this problem.
